A rapid and sensitive fluorometric assay of serum phospholipid

Abstract

A fluorometric assay of phospholipid in serum is presented. The reaction is based upon the binding of phospholipids with a fluorescent probe: 1-6-Diphenyl-1-3-5 hexatriene (DPH). The method is in very good agreement with other techniques for phospholipid estimation: phosphorus assay phospholipid extraction (Fiske and Subarrow), and enzymatic assay of phospholipid containing choline (Takayama). The correlation coefficient obtained was 0.81, when the proposed method was compared with the two other ones. Parameters influencing the reaction: DPH concentration, time and temperature of incubation are described. The normal range for human serum lies between 2.1 and 3.4 mmol/l. The sensitivity of the fluorometric assay is also sufficient for the determination of phospholipid in amniotic fluid and broncho-alveolar washings.
